当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器的搭建和配置方案,基于Linux系统的服务器搭建与配置实战教程

服务器的搭建和配置方案,基于Linux系统的服务器搭建与配置实战教程

本教程详细介绍了基于Linux系统的服务器搭建与配置实战,涵盖从基础环境搭建到高级配置,旨在帮助读者掌握服务器搭建与配置的实用技能。...

本教程详细介绍了基于Linux系统的服务器搭建与配置实战,涵盖从基础环境搭建到高级配置,旨在帮助读者掌握服务器搭建与配置的实用技能。

随着互联网的飞速发展,服务器在各个行业中的地位越来越重要,掌握服务器搭建和配置技术,已经成为IT行业从业者的必备技能,本文将详细介绍基于Linux系统的服务器搭建与配置方案,包括硬件选择、系统安装、网络配置、安全设置等方面,旨在帮助读者快速掌握服务器搭建与配置技术。

硬件选择

1、CPU:选择性能稳定的CPU,如Intel Xeon或AMD EPYC系列,保证服务器运行效率。

2、内存:根据服务器用途选择合适的内存容量,一般建议至少8GB,高端应用可考虑16GB以上。

3、硬盘:根据存储需求选择硬盘类型,如SATA、SSD或NVMe SSD,SSD具有读写速度快、寿命长等特点,适合作为系统盘或数据盘。

服务器的搭建和配置方案,基于Linux系统的服务器搭建与配置实战教程

4、电源:选择品牌稳定、功率足够的电源,确保服务器稳定运行。

5、机箱:选择散热性能良好、扩展性强的机箱,便于维护和升级。

6、网卡:选择千兆或万兆网卡,确保网络传输速率。

系统安装

1、下载Linux系统镜像:从官方网站下载适合的Linux系统镜像,如CentOS、Ubuntu等。

2、创建启动U盘:使用 Rufus 或其他工具将镜像烧录到U盘。

3、设置BIOS启动顺序:进入BIOS设置,将U盘设置为第一启动设备。

4、安装Linux系统:按照提示进行系统安装,选择适合的分区方式。

5、安装完成后,重启服务器,并设置登录密码。

服务器的搭建和配置方案,基于Linux系统的服务器搭建与配置实战教程

网络配置

1、配置IP地址:使用 ifconfig 或 ip 命令查看网络接口,并使用 ifconfig 命令或 nmcli 命令配置静态IP地址。

2、设置DNS:在 /etc/resolv.conf 文件中添加DNS服务器地址。

3、配置防火墙:使用 iptables 或 nftables 命令配置防火墙规则,确保服务器安全。

4、测试网络连接:使用 ping 命令测试服务器与其他设备的网络连接。

安全设置

1、更新系统:使用 yum 或 apt-get 命令更新系统,确保系统安全。

2、安装安全软件:安装安全软件,如 fail2ban、ClamAV 等,提高服务器安全性。

3、修改默认端口:修改常见服务的默认端口,如SSH、HTTP等,降低被攻击风险。

4、设置用户权限:为用户设置合适的权限,避免未授权访问。

服务器的搭建和配置方案,基于Linux系统的服务器搭建与配置实战教程

5、关闭不必要的服务等:关闭不必要的服务,降低系统攻击面。

常见服务配置

1、Web服务:安装Apache、Nginx等Web服务器,配置虚拟主机、SSL证书等。

2、数据库服务:安装MySQL、MariaDB等数据库,配置数据库用户、权限等。

3、文件服务:安装Samba、NFS等文件服务,实现文件共享。

4、邮件服务:安装Postfix、Dovecot等邮件服务,配置邮件服务器。

5、DNS服务:安装BIND等DNS服务,实现域名解析。

本文详细介绍了基于Linux系统的服务器搭建与配置方案,包括硬件选择、系统安装、网络配置、安全设置等方面,通过学习本文,读者可以快速掌握服务器搭建与配置技术,为后续学习和工作打下坚实基础,在实际操作过程中,还需根据具体需求进行调整和优化。

黑狐家游戏

发表评论

最新文章